Abstract:
PROBLEM TO BE SOLVED: To provide a cooling device for a direct-injection engine capable of appropriately supplying cooling water to a fuel cooler and an intercooler in accordance with an operating state of the direct-injection engine and thus effectively using a cooling action of the cooling water and of suppressing a waste operation of a water pump.SOLUTION: During an operation of an engine 1, a drive duty of a water pump 38 is set based on request heat radiation amounts Qa, Qb to a fuel cooler 29 and an intercooler 22, and cooling water from the water pump 38 is distributed by a flow control valve 37 to the fuel cooler 29 side and the intercooler 22 side at a predetermined ratio. On the other hand, during stop of the engine 1, the drive duty of the water pump 38 is set based on request heat radiation amounts Qa, Qc to the fuel cooler 29 and a bearing section 21c of a turbocharger 21, and the cooling water from the water pump 38 is supplied by the flow control valve 37 to the turbocharger 21 via the fuel cooler 29.SELECTED DRAWING: Figure 1
